Tomislav Kopjar is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Surgery and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Tomislav Kopjar has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 347 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 17 papers in Surgery and 6 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Tomislav Kopjar's work include Cardiac Valve Diseases and Treatments (8 papers), Cardiac and Coronary Surgery Techniques (8 papers) and Antiplatelet Therapy and Cardiovascular Diseases (6 papers). Tomislav Kopjar is often cited by papers focused on Cardiac Valve Diseases and Treatments (8 papers), Cardiac and Coronary Surgery Techniques (8 papers) and Antiplatelet Therapy and Cardiovascular Diseases (6 papers). Tomislav Kopjar collaborates with scholars based in Croatia, United Kingdom and Spain. Tomislav Kopjar's co-authors include Hrvoje Gašparović, Bojan Biočina, Mate Petričević, Davor Miličić, Michael R. Dashwood, Maja Čikeš, Carlos A. Mestres, Marko Boban, Bruno Botelho Pinheiro and Domingos Souza and has published in prestigious journals such as The American Journal of Cardiology, Journal of Thoracic and Cardiovascular Surgery and The Annals of Thoracic Surgery.
